noun
- A visual presentation showing how something works.
- usage: "the lecture was accompanied by dramatic demonstrations"; "the lecturer shot off a pistol as a demonstration of the startle response"
- synonyms: demonstration
verb
- Give an exhibition of to an interested audience.
- usage: "She shows her dogs frequently"; "We will demo the new software in Washington"
- synonyms: show, exhibit, present, demonstrate
